Dramaturgy and Development Testimonials

"When McKerrin agreed to direct a staged reading of my latest full-length play I was thrilled. I’d seen productions she’d helmed around town and was hopeful she’d bring the same smarts and insight to my burgeoning work. In short: I was not disappointed. Throughout the prep and rehearsal process McKerrin was consistently available, prepared and thoughtful, while always being sensitive to my needs as the writer (And to be clear, there were times I was nothing short of a nervous f*@!ing wreck). Not only did my script become stronger thanks to McKerrin’s guidance and feedback, I became a better writer. I’d gladly work with her again in a heartbeat."


Dan Perry
Playwright and Screenwriter

I have had the good fortune to have McKerrin lend her directorial acumen to three of my plays — a full production, a workshop production, and a script in development. McKerrin has a particularly keen eye for building and sustaining story arc and mining and deepening character development all in service of strengthening and growing the script — making the play in front of her the best play it can be. What’s unique about McKerrin’s directorial style is that she does not come in and immediately attempt try to imprint her signature on a script. She is inclusive and creative and partners with the writer and actors to organically grow the script, ask probing questions about intent and objective, and solicit input from all players while possessing the ability to gently guide things back on track should the process start veering off course.

Jeremy Kehoe
Playwright

"McKerrin Kelly has been essential in the development of several of my plays. She understands the intent of the writer and makes sure all of her feedback and guidance are geared toward helping them hone her/his/their script into the strongest possible version of the story she/he/they want(s) to tell. She gets the playwright excited to more deeply explore the themes and world she/he/they created, rather than ever making it feel like she's saying, 'Well, this is how I would write it.' McKerrin is equally skilled as a director, encouraging the actors to explore the words as honestly as possible so the playwright can see without any doubt whether what she/he/they have on the page works or requires further work."

Kerry Kazmerowicstrimm
Playwright, Screenwriter
